MANILA – President Ferdinand Marcos Jr. designated Deputy Ombudsman for the Visayas Dante Vargas as acting Ombudsman, Malacañang confirmed on Wednesday.

"Confirmed," was Presidential Communications Office (PCO) Undersecretary Claire Castro's reply in a text message to reporters.

Vargas was appointed to the Office of the Ombudsman by former president Rodrigo Duterte in March 2022.
He will take over special prosecutor Mariflor Punzalan-Castillo who has been sitting as officer-in-charge of the anti-graft court since late July after Samuel Martires completed his mandated seven-year term.
Vargas shall oversee affairs at the agency until Marcos names a permanent Ombudsman.
